The Delicate Process of Bringing Art Back to Life

Art restoration is like medicine for masterpieces. At THE ART FACTORY, we follow these careful steps:

  1. Assessment – Examining the artwork to understand its condition and needs
  2. Documentation – Recording the current state before any work begins
  3. Cleaning – Gently removing dirt, smoke residue, and yellowed varnish
  4. Repair – Fixing tears, cracks, and structural issues
  5. Retouching – Carefully addressing paint loss while respecting the original work
  6. Protection – Adding conservation-grade varnish or other protective elements

Each type of art requires different care. Paper art might need deacidification to prevent yellowing, while oil paintings might require canvas repairs. Sculptures demand yet another set of skills to address broken elements or weathering damage.

Restoration vs. Replacement: Why Original Art Matters

In today’s world of mass production, it’s tempting to replace damaged art with new prints or reproductions. But original artwork carries energy, history, and craftsmanship that can’t be duplicated.

When you restore rather than replace, you preserve:

  • The artist’s original intention and technique
  • Historical materials and methods
  • The artwork’s authentic connection to its time period
  • The genuine emotional impact of the piece

Starting Your Restoration Journey

Do you have artwork that needs attention? Look for these warning signs:

  • Yellowing or darkening
  • Cracks in the paint surface
  • Tears or holes
  • Water damage stains
  • Fading colors
  • Frames falling apart
